Lindenow · Suburb / Locality
Long-term health conditions and the need for help with everyday activities.
Over a third of people in Lindenow live with a long-term health condition, which is well above the national figure. This higher rate of illness is mirrored in the number of people who require daily help, making health a significant part of life for many residents.
Long-term conditions people report.
About 32.8% of residents have a long-term health condition, which is well above the Victorian average of 27.4%. Arthritis is the most common issue at 12.1%, while 10.4% of people report a mental health condition.

People needing help with daily activities.
Daily help is needed by 8.2% of the population. This is much higher than in most similar areas and sits a little above the national figure of 5.8%.
